某建于深厚软土地基上的6层住宅,紧邻地铁车站深基坑且其条形基础下局部有暗浜,在车站深基坑施工过程中,发生沉降并倾斜严重。针对所在场地条件复杂、环保要求高等特点,在深基坑施工过程中综合运用了多种手段对房屋进行沉降及倾斜控制,达到了房屋保护和安全经济的目的。
A 6-storied residential building built on thick soft ground was settled and severely inclined in the construction of the foundation pit of a subway station due to its close adjacency to the station and the influence of an underground creek somewhere beneath its strip foundation.Taking into account the complicated field conditions and the requirements of environmental protection,comprehensive methods of inclination and settlement controls were used in the construction of the neighboring pit,by which the targets of building protection ,safety and economy were reached
